Remove Ads

Photo of Microsoft One Esterra Cafe

Microsoft One Esterra Cafe

15550 NE Turing St, Redmond, Washington 98052 USA

0 Reviews

Breakfast Burrito

Photo Credit: Yelp

Remove Ads